El documento proporciona una introducción a los tipos de datos, consultas y funciones en MySQL. Explica los tipos de datos numéricos, de cadena y fecha, y describe la sintaxis básica de las consultas SQL como SELECT, FROM, WHERE, GROUP BY y ORDER BY. También resume los operadores lógicos, aritméticos y funciones agregadas comunes en MySQL.
Analisis de los modelos de bases de datos basadas en grafos centrándose en Neo4J así como de su funcionamiento interno y arquitectura y el lenguaje Cypher.
Analisis de los modelos de bases de datos basadas en grafos centrándose en Neo4J así como de su funcionamiento interno y arquitectura y el lenguaje Cypher.
MySQL Workbench Tutorial | Introduction To MySQL Workbench | MySQL DBA Traini...Edureka!
** MYSQL DBA Certification Training https://www.edureka.co/mysql-dba **
This Edureka tutorial on MySQL Workbench explains all the fundamentals of MySQL Workbench with examples.
The following are the topics covered in this tutorial:
What is MySQL Workbench?
MySQL Workbench Functionaltites
MySQL Workbench Editions
The Three Modules of Workbench
1. SQL Development
2. Data Modelling
3. Migration Wizard
Data Import & Export
Subscribe to our Edureka YouTube channel and hit the bell icon to get video updates: https://goo.gl/6ohpT
Follow us to never miss an update in the future.
Instagram: https://www.instagram.com/edureka_learning/
Facebook: https://www.facebook.com/edurekaIN/
Twitter: https://twitter.com/edurekain
LinkedIn: https://www.linkedin.com/company/edureka
MySQL Tutorial For Beginners | Relational Database Management System | MySQL ...Edureka!
( ** MYSQL DBA Certification Training https://www.edureka.co/mysql-dba ** )
This Edureka tutorial PPT on MySQL explains all the fundamentals of MySQL with examples.
The following are the topics covered in this tutorial:
1. What is Database & DBMS?
2. Structured Query Language
3. MySQL & MySQL Workbench
4. Entity Relationship Diagram
5. Normalization
6. SQL Operations & Commands
Follow us to never miss an update in the future.
Instagram: https://www.instagram.com/edureka_learning/
Facebook: https://www.facebook.com/edurekaIN/
Twitter: https://twitter.com/edurekain
LinkedIn: https://www.linkedin.com/company/edureka
MySQL Workbench Tutorial | Introduction To MySQL Workbench | MySQL DBA Traini...Edureka!
** MYSQL DBA Certification Training https://www.edureka.co/mysql-dba **
This Edureka tutorial on MySQL Workbench explains all the fundamentals of MySQL Workbench with examples.
The following are the topics covered in this tutorial:
What is MySQL Workbench?
MySQL Workbench Functionaltites
MySQL Workbench Editions
The Three Modules of Workbench
1. SQL Development
2. Data Modelling
3. Migration Wizard
Data Import & Export
Subscribe to our Edureka YouTube channel and hit the bell icon to get video updates: https://goo.gl/6ohpT
Follow us to never miss an update in the future.
Instagram: https://www.instagram.com/edureka_learning/
Facebook: https://www.facebook.com/edurekaIN/
Twitter: https://twitter.com/edurekain
LinkedIn: https://www.linkedin.com/company/edureka
MySQL Tutorial For Beginners | Relational Database Management System | MySQL ...Edureka!
( ** MYSQL DBA Certification Training https://www.edureka.co/mysql-dba ** )
This Edureka tutorial PPT on MySQL explains all the fundamentals of MySQL with examples.
The following are the topics covered in this tutorial:
1. What is Database & DBMS?
2. Structured Query Language
3. MySQL & MySQL Workbench
4. Entity Relationship Diagram
5. Normalization
6. SQL Operations & Commands
Follow us to never miss an update in the future.
Instagram: https://www.instagram.com/edureka_learning/
Facebook: https://www.facebook.com/edurekaIN/
Twitter: https://twitter.com/edurekain
LinkedIn: https://www.linkedin.com/company/edureka
Normalización de la base de datos (3 formas normales)michell_quitian
Existen 3 niveles de normalización que deben respetarse para poder decir que nuestra Base de Datos, se encuentra NORMALIZADA, es decir, que cumple con los requisitos naturales para funcionar óptimamente.
Un compendio de sentencias SQL, trata desde las sentencias DDL hasta las DML, INSERT, UPDATE, DELETE, CREATE, ALTER,se presentan mediante ejemplos detallando su estructura. Se incluyen la creación de restricciones,el borrado de las mismas y el manejo de las llaves primarias, foraneas e indices.
Las subconsultas son incluidas, así como el trabajo con WHERE, el GROUP BY y el HAVING, considerando los operadores de grupo AVG y MAX.
Se concibe la presentación como una guía rápida de referencia para SQL.
Se baso en el SQL compatible para ORACLE
Breve resumen acerca del funcionamiento de los Servidores de Nombres de Dominio, resolución inversa, tipos de dominios (según su nivel) y fingerprinting con (conocer el sistema operativo de un servidor con nmap).
(PROYECTO) Límites entre el Arte, los Medios de Comunicación y la Informáticavazquezgarciajesusma
En este proyecto de investigación nos adentraremos en el fascinante mundo de la intersección entre el arte y los medios de comunicación en el campo de la informática.
La rápida evolución de la tecnología ha llevado a una fusión cada vez más estrecha entre el arte y los medios digitales, generando nuevas formas de expresión y comunicación.
Continuando con el desarrollo de nuestro proyecto haremos uso del método inductivo porque organizamos nuestra investigación a la particular a lo general. El diseño metodológico del trabajo es no experimental y transversal ya que no existe manipulación deliberada de las variables ni de la situación, si no que se observa los fundamental y como se dan en su contestó natural para después analizarlos.
El diseño es transversal porque los datos se recolectan en un solo momento y su propósito es describir variables y analizar su interrelación, solo se desea saber la incidencia y el valor de uno o más variables, el diseño será descriptivo porque se requiere establecer relación entre dos o más de estás.
Mediante una encuesta recopilamos la información de este proyecto los alumnos tengan conocimiento de la evolución del arte y los medios de comunicación en la información y su importancia para la institución.
Índice del libro "Big Data: Tecnologías para arquitecturas Data-Centric" de 0...Telefónica
Índice del libro "Big Data: Tecnologías para arquitecturas Data-Centric" de 0xWord escrito por Ibón Reinoso ( https://mypublicinbox.com/IBhone ) con Prólogo de Chema Alonso ( https://mypublicinbox.com/ChemaAlonso ). Puedes comprarlo aquí: https://0xword.com/es/libros/233-big-data-tecnologias-para-arquitecturas-data-centric.html
Inteligencia Artificial y Ciberseguridad.pdfEmilio Casbas
Recopilación de los puntos más interesantes de diversas presentaciones, desde los visionarios conceptos de Alan Turing, pasando por la paradoja de Hans Moravec y la descripcion de Singularidad de Max Tegmark, hasta los innovadores avances de ChatGPT, y de cómo la IA está transformando la seguridad digital y protegiendo nuestras vidas.
(PROYECTO) Límites entre el Arte, los Medios de Comunicación y la Informáticavazquezgarciajesusma
En este proyecto de investigación nos adentraremos en el fascinante mundo de la intersección entre el arte y los medios de comunicación en el campo de la informática.
La rápida evolución de la tecnología ha llevado a una fusión cada vez más estrecha entre el arte y los medios digitales, generando nuevas formas de expresión y comunicación.
Continuando con el desarrollo de nuestro proyecto haremos uso del método inductivo porque organizamos nuestra investigación a la particular a lo general. El diseño metodológico del trabajo es no experimental y transversal ya que no existe manipulación deliberada de las variables ni de la situación, si no que se observa los fundamental y como se dan en su contestó natural para después analizarlos.
El diseño es transversal porque los datos se recolectan en un solo momento y su propósito es describir variables y analizar su interrelación, solo se desea saber la incidencia y el valor de uno o más variables, el diseño será descriptivo porque se requiere establecer relación entre dos o más de estás.
Mediante una encuesta recopilamos la información de este proyecto los alumnos tengan conocimiento de la evolución del arte y los medios de comunicación en la información y su importancia para la institución.
Actualmente, y debido al desarrollo tecnológico de campos como la informática y la electrónica, la mayoría de las bases de datos están en formato digital, siendo este un componente electrónico, por tanto se ha desarrollado y se ofrece un amplio rango de soluciones al problema del almacenamiento de datos.
1. Resumen básico de consultas y funciones en MySQL
MySQL es un sistema gestor de bases de datos relacionales (SGBDR) corporativo de código abierto, muy
utilizado para dar soporte a la gestión de los datos en aplicaciones web, a menudo juntamente con
Apache i el PHP.
Los tipos de datos string almacenan datos alfanuméricos en el conjunto de carácteres de la base de
datos.
MySQL proporciona los tipos de datos siguientes para gestionar datos alfanuméricos: CHAR, VARCHAR,
BINARY, VARBINARY, BLOB, TEXT, ENUM y SET.
MySQL soporta todos los tipos de datos numéricos de SQL estándard: INT, SMALLINT, DEC o FIXED y
NUMERIC. También soporta FLOAT, REAL, DOUBLE, BIT y BOOLEAN.
El tipo de datos de que MySQL dispone para almacenar datos que indiquen momentos temporales son:
DATETIME, DATE, TIMESTAMP, TIME y YEAR.
Sintaxis y estructura de las consultas
La cláusula SELECT, de SQL, permite escoger columnas y valores derivados de estas.
La opción DISTINCT acompañado de la cláusula SELECT permite especificar que se quiere un único
ejemplar para las filas repetidas.
La cláusula FROM, de SQL, permite especificar las tablas en las que se ha de restringir la búsqueda de la
cláusula SELECT.
Otras cláusulas adicionales son:
- ORDER BY que permite ordenar el resultado de la consulta (ASC/DESC).
- WHERE permite establecer los criterios de búsqueda sobre las filas generadas por la cláusula
FROM.
- GROUP BY permite agrupar las filas resultantes de las cláusulas SELECT, FROM y WHERE según
una o más de las columnas seleccionadas.
- HAVING permite especificar condiciones de filtraje sobre los grupos resultantes de la cláusula
GROUP BY.
La sintaxis básica de una cláusula SELECT es:
select [[distinct] <expressión/columna>, <expressión/columna>,...
from <tabla>, <tabla>,...
[where <condición de búsqueda>]
[group by <alias/columna>, <alias/columna>,...]
[having <condición sobre grupos>]
[order by <expressión/columna> [asc|desc], <expressión/columna> [asc|desc],...];
2. Operadores lógicos básicas en MySQL
- OR (Condición1 OR Condición2)
Obliga a cumplir una u otra condición
- AND (Condición1 AND Condición2)
Obliga a cumplir varias condiciones al mismo tiempo.
- NOT o ! (WHERE valor !0)
Permite establecer negaciones. Puede aplicarse a cualquier expresión.
Operadores aritméticos en MySQL
- Operadores básicos: + , - , * , / , ^
- DIV División con resultado entero
- MOD Resto de una división
Funciones de agrupación complementarias a GROUP BY
- AVG () Calcula la media de los argumentos del campo indicado.
- COUNT () Cuenta registros o argumentos.
- MIN () Indica el valor mínimo de los argumentos del campo indicado.
- MAX () Indica el valor máximo de los argumentos del campo indicado.
- SUM () Suma los argumentos del campo indicado.
Otras funciones y operadores
- BEETWEEN (Campo BEETWEEN valor1 AND valor)
Especifica un rango determinado.
- LIKE Operador de comparación de cadenas de caracteres.
(“_” representa a un solo carácter desconocido, mientras que “%” representa
a cualquier número de carácteres desconocidos.)
- IN (Campo IN (valor1,valor2,valor3)
Hace que solo se muestren los registros cuyo “Campo” contenga uno de los
valores indicados en la expresión.
- IS NULL / IS NOT NULL (Campo IS NULL)
Establece como condición que un campo sea nulo o no.
- IS TRUE / FALSE (Campo IS true/false)
Establece como condición que un campo tenga un valor boleano
verdadero o falso.
- AS ((Campo1 + Campo2) AS CampoSuma)
Asigna un alias a un campo o expresión.
- CAST () ( CAST(Campo o expresión) AS tipo de datos nuevo)
Permite la conversión a un tipo de datos diferente.
UNSIGNED -- hace referencia a enteros con signo.
- DATE_FORMAT () ( DATE_FORMAT(CampoFecha,'%d/%m/%Y'))
Permite establecer un formato de fecha específico.
(%d = día, %m = mes, %Y = año | las mayúsculas son importantes)
- NOW () Devuelve la hora y fecha actuales en el sistema.
- DATEDIFF (Fecha1,Fecha2) Permite calcular la diferencia entre fechas.
- YEAR / MONTH / DAY () Toma únicamente el año/mes/dia de un campo fecha.